Lenovo Client Virtualization with Citrix XenDesktop
• Platforms supported in this RA
– System x3550, System x3650; Flex System x240
• Hypervisors Supported
– XenDesktop is an open architecture that supports several hypervisors
– VMware ESXi (vSphere), Citrix XenServer, and Microsoft Hyper-V
• Provisioning – Two Types
– Provisioning Services (PVS) – Streams a single desktop image to create multiple virtual desktops on one or more servers; Pro: VM on a target device does not need local hard disk drive to operate;
– Machine Creation Services (MCS) - Streams a single desktop image using integrated functionality built into the hypervisor; Pro: Requires fewer servers
• User Types
– Office Workers – Outlook, Word, PowerPoint, Excel
– Power Workers – CAD, Programmers, Video Creation
– Knowledge Workers – SAP, Finance

Citrix XenDesktop RA - Sizing for User Types
• Compute server recommendation for Office workers
• “The default recommendation for this processor family is the Xeon E5-2680v4 processor and 512 GB of system memory because this configuration provides the best coverage for a range of users. Lenovo testing shows that 225 users per server is a good baseline and has an average of 75% usage of the processors in the server. If a server goes down, users on that server must be transferred to the remaining servers. For this degraded failover case, Lenovo testing shows that 270 users per server have an average of 87% usage of the processors. It is important to keep this 25% headroom on servers to cope with possible failover scenarios”
• Compute server recommendation for Knowledge workers
• “For knowledge workers the default recommendation for this processor family is the Xeon E5-2680v4 processor and 512 GB of system memory. Lenovo testing shows that 175 users per server is a good baseline and has an average of 77% usage of the processors in the server. If a server goes down…”
• Compute server recommendation for Power workers
• “For power workers, the default recommendation for this processor family is the Xeon E5-2699v4 processor and 768 GB of system memory. Lenovo testing shows that 175 users per server is a good baseline and has an average of 72% usage of the processors in the server. If a server goes down…”

Citrix XenDesktop RA - Sizing for Graphics Accelerators
• Guidance provided for all three supported hypervisors and for multiple GPUs
• The VMware ESXi hypervisor supports the following options for multiple GPUs and modes of operation
– Dedicated GPU with one GPU per user: Virtual dedicated graphics acceleration (vDGA) mode
– GPU hardware virtualization (vGPU) for 1 - 8 users
– Shared GPU with users sharing a GPU: Virtual shared graphics acceleration (vSGA)

Anatomy of a Write I/O
Node
Guest VM
Hypervisor
Controller VM
Storage
Node Node
Performance and availability
• Data is written locally
• Replicated on other nodes for high availability
• Replicas are spread across cluster for high performance

Citrix XenDesktop & VMware Horizon on HX Series All Flash
The Lenovo Converged HX3310 hybrid appliance has been complimented
with an all flash variant:
The results for all flash and hybrid are somewhat similar for relatively low
logon rates of every 30 seconds, with the HX-3310-F providing some
slight advantages.
However as the logon rate increases, the all flash HX3310-F appliance
delivers better performance compared to the hybrid HX3310 appliance.
The all flash appliance has a higher capacity for IOPS and lower
latencies, particularly for the write requests that occur during a logon and
any accesses to slower hard drives is eliminated.
